Commit Graph

  • a475240ec0 tests/lib/nested: collect logs and enable snapd debug when building images Maciej Borzecki 2024-03-11 17:23:38 +01:00
  • dd5950fd5c data/preseed: add /var/lib/snapd/cgroup to preseed include patterns Maciej Borzecki 2024-03-11 17:20:01 +01:00
  • ab28d46dd1 interfaces/udev: do not call udev when in preseed mode Maciej Borzecki 2024-03-11 15:48:22 +01:00
  • 54678062b3 tests: add github workflow to run tiobeweb tool (#13687) Sergio Cazzolato 2024-03-12 14:20:36 +02:00
  • 81d3d515f0 steam_support: add comment regarding need for /usr/share driver info ashuntu 2024-03-06 17:31:16 -06:00
  • 9dfe8cf278 steam_support: combine /snap rules ashuntu 2024-03-04 09:38:59 -06:00
  • 466aa7638f steam_support: allow reading of hostfs /usr/share/nvidia files ashuntu 2024-02-13 21:14:00 -06:00
  • 05d2d5b294 steam_support: allow mounting of snap and hostfs directories ashuntu 2024-02-13 16:14:45 -06:00
  • c57901e705 many: add API routes for creating/removing recovery systems (#13651) Andrew Phelps 2024-03-10 16:35:04 -04:00
  • f079986ac9 tests: exclude regression-lp2044335 from core Zygmunt Krynicki 2024-03-08 16:18:30 +01:00
  • f79c5b44b3 tests: add regression test for LP:#2044335 Zygmunt Krynicki 2024-02-14 10:56:51 +01:00
  • a406349529 i/builtin: system-packages-doc bare snap workaround Zygmunt Krynicki 2024-02-05 09:55:25 +00:00
  • c0059170df interfaces/builtin: add interface for remoteproc Buğra Aydoğar 2024-01-30 14:56:48 +03:00
  • e46b98c17d tests: use strace-static from candidate channel Zygmunt Krynicki 2024-03-07 13:33:56 +01:00
  • 2ab0074172 strace: Re-format comment regarding strace compatiblity. Zygmunt Krynicki 2024-03-06 14:15:56 +01:00
  • c50bb3c3ea strace: break out strace user handling to a helper Zygmunt Krynicki 2024-03-06 14:13:56 +01:00
  • e69702f0de tests: enable "snap run --strace" test on UC22 Michael Vogt 2023-09-13 09:22:51 +02:00
  • 87069b1bc5 strace: use --gid/--uid options Tony Espy 2023-09-06 17:28:43 -04:00
  • 29a6e751a5 overlord,systemd: restart mount units when changed Alfonso Sánchez-Beato 2024-02-23 14:22:29 +00:00
  • f66932bef2 aspects: support unmatched placeholders w/ unset (#13660) Miguel Pires 2024-03-07 14:57:35 +00:00
  • 69528a936a interfaces/udev, cmd/snap-confine: support for snaps managing own device cgroups (#13642) Maciej Borzecki 2024-03-07 13:23:58 +01:00
  • 0e9d0f49e5 Merge pull request #13675 from ernestl/changelogs-2.61.3 Ernest Lotter 2024-03-07 12:10:56 +02:00
  • db27649340 interfaces/builtin: add interface for kernel-firmware-control Buğra Aydoğar 2024-03-05 10:01:41 +03:00
  • 4194045021 release: 2.61.3 ernestl 2024-03-06 23:23:22 +02:00
  • 12e48ef9a6 release: 2.61.3 2.61.3 release/2.61 ernestl 2024-03-06 23:23:22 +02:00
  • d057e9be23 tests: add spread tests support for ubuntu-24.04 (#13426) Sergio Cazzolato 2023-12-15 20:07:34 +02:00
  • f25be694b7 packaging/ubuntu-16.04: install systemd files in correct place on 24.04 Valentin David 2024-02-15 14:40:36 +01:00
  • 4175ceb23b packaging: wrap-and-sort -d ubuntu-14.04 Zygmunt Krynicki 2024-02-29 14:56:48 +01:00
  • d1935b25d3 packaging: wrap-and-sort -d ubuntu-16.04 Zygmunt Krynicki 2024-02-29 14:56:18 +01:00
  • 289cde80ce packaging: wrap-and-sort -d debian-sid Zygmunt Krynicki 2024-02-29 14:55:52 +01:00
  • 32c0489d28 tests: new perf test install-many-snaps (#13478) Sergio Cazzolato 2024-03-06 18:26:46 +02:00
  • 68fe7eb9f7 tests: support testflinger (#13662) Sergio Cazzolato 2024-03-05 13:51:21 +02:00
  • a7d24c95df aspects: support content sub-rules (#13627) Miguel Pires 2024-03-05 11:35:14 +00:00
  • 65206a409c steam_support: generalize pressure-vessel root paths (#13489) Ash 2024-03-05 11:29:28 +00:00
  • eba5f39bb4 many: add snap-refresh-observe interface Zeyad Gouda 2024-03-01 17:41:25 +02:00
  • bc7f9eccc2 many: remove snap data home directories Zeyad Gouda 2024-02-27 22:16:32 +02:00
  • a950bc5e8e go.mod: drop unused gopkg.in/mgo.v2 Zygmunt Krynicki 2024-02-29 14:13:30 +01:00
  • a39482ead5 tests: add regression test for exploding namespace Zygmunt Krynicki 2024-02-29 10:45:48 +01:00
  • 1aaf325aa3 cmd/snap-confine: fix exploding homedirs bug Zygmunt Krynicki 2024-02-28 10:31:21 +01:00
  • a910533fd7 tests/main/security-device-cgroups-required-or-optional: simple spread test Maciej Borzecki 2024-02-26 16:00:07 +01:00
  • 7b2cc922d7 cmd/snap-confine: always set up the device cgroup unless using one of the old bases Maciej Borzecki 2018-11-06 11:53:03 +01:00
  • 147634b1a7 o/devicestate: remove unused method Miguel Pires 2024-02-29 17:07:55 +00:00
  • 51e1c651e7 aspects: rename user-defined types to aliases Miguel Pires 2024-02-28 14:01:38 +00:00
  • e2b17d0250 o/devicestate: add concept of default-recovery-system (#13634) Andrew Phelps 2024-02-29 11:36:00 -05:00
  • 5455753b46 build-aux: add libzstd to snapd snap for snap pack Philip Meulengracht 2024-02-29 12:39:13 +01:00
  • d7ce4f9e15 o/snapstate: record refresh-inhibit notices when auto-refresh is blocked Zeyad Gouda 2024-02-14 15:35:07 +02:00
  • 3b3e116f90 o/state,daemon: add refresh-inhibit notice Zeyad Gouda 2024-02-13 18:01:33 +02:00
  • dc1cb973c8 o/snapstate: fix Stop() call ordering for SnapManager unit tests Zeyad Gouda 2024-02-13 17:51:15 +02:00
  • 86ec82f140 c/snap-repair: make snap-repair exit 0 when the store is marked as offline Andrew Phelps 2024-02-16 15:00:40 -05:00
  • 54de5bb7ca tests/lib/assertions: add missing assertion that was preventing nested/manual/remodel-offline from running Andrew Phelps 2024-02-19 10:43:44 -05:00
  • fa7838a5ed o/snapstate: record change-update notice on forced refresh Zeyad Gouda 2024-02-27 23:03:05 +02:00
  • 8996c3602b tests: allow running edge/beta validation in google instances (#13639) Sergio Cazzolato 2024-02-29 15:09:56 +02:00
  • 4c981d7587 interfaces/builtin/network_setup_observe: allow busctl to bind Maciej Borzecki 2024-02-29 10:44:46 +01:00
  • 89c456e5de interfaces/builtin/network_setup_control: allow busctl to bind Maciej Borzecki 2024-02-29 09:48:02 +01:00
  • b9606c845e interfaces/builtin/libvirt: add read permissions to /var/lib/snapd/ho… (#13645) Jorge Sancho Larraz 2024-02-29 13:11:43 +01:00
  • 2fd765ab52 github: mention C source code formatting tools we expect Maciej Borzecki 2024-02-29 09:04:46 +01:00
  • 2c8be76d8c interfaces: make steam-support implicit on core (#13189) James Henstridge 2024-02-29 16:32:37 +08:00
  • 177eccbd48 snap: add hooks to snap component types (#13538) Andrew Phelps 2024-02-28 09:02:58 -05:00
  • 41512c4860 many: add "refresh-inhibited" select query to /v2/snaps Zeyad Gouda 2024-02-20 11:05:22 +02:00
  • 5147ac3463 overlord/configstate/configcore: add support rpi config sdtv_mode option ernestl 2024-02-28 00:25:16 +02:00
  • cc8b783d2b interfaces/backend: update sandbox features to account for cgroup v2 device filtering Maciej Borzecki 2024-02-27 09:02:33 +01:00
  • 72b0aef66b o/devicestate: skip optional snaps in model when creating recovery system Andrew Phelps 2024-02-20 17:06:07 -05:00
  • 069b7f684e many: use interfaces.SnapAppSet in security backends (#13587) Andrew Phelps 2024-02-27 14:52:02 -05:00
  • e502466c4c cmd/libsnap-confine-private/infofile: support for comments Maciej Borzecki 2024-02-27 11:07:25 +01:00
  • 35007470f2 github: build indent Maciej Borzecki 2024-02-26 15:57:51 +01:00
  • 415e05304d cmd: add explicit pointer-align-right for indent Maciej Borzecki 2024-02-26 14:54:44 +01:00
  • accb1d4cd8 cmd: many: apply C source code formatting Maciej Borzecki 2024-02-26 14:44:31 +01:00
  • 8048a4cabc github: verify C source code formatting Maciej Borzecki 2024-02-26 13:46:40 +01:00
  • 360fec7c67 o/state: record change-update notices on change status updates Zeyad Gouda 2024-01-30 15:40:42 +02:00
  • bebd832e62 aspects: check path type mismatch on aspect creation (#13635) Miguel Pires 2024-02-27 12:42:31 +00:00
  • b280382184 o/devicestate: add RemoveRecoverySystem function for removing a recovery system (#13546) Andrew Phelps 2024-02-26 14:43:26 -05:00
  • 8d91db05dc aspects: empty Get request returns entire aspect (#13622) Miguel Pires 2024-02-26 17:42:11 +00:00
  • de661037d7 o/snapstate: simplify updating of refresh-candidates (#13626) Maciej Borzecki 2024-02-26 09:58:46 +01:00
  • acd3ee9df5 daemon: replace notices "select" param with "users" Oliver Calder 2024-02-22 17:13:55 -06:00
  • 23cbbf078b i/builtin: use pointer into main array instead to not store copies Philip Meulengracht 2024-02-23 12:15:05 +01:00
  • 765f72ee50 i/builtin: do not use pointer to the local for-loop variable, instead use copies Philip Meulengracht 2024-02-23 11:18:25 +01:00
  • f7fea7fef0 daemon: allow polkit "io.snapcraft.snapd.manage" for /v2/apps endpoint Philip Meulengracht 2023-11-17 09:17:12 +01:00
  • 4e6e3bdbeb tests/lib/tools/tests.invariant: ignore session for user ubuntu Valentin David 2024-02-22 14:31:21 +01:00
  • 9d9f2be62d o/assertstate: rename variables to be a bit clearer Andrew Phelps 2024-02-22 14:34:40 -05:00
  • 04fd0ecdde o/assertstate: use ValidationSetKey to create unique identifiers for validation sets Andrew Phelps 2024-02-21 09:17:10 -05:00
  • a1e658d67c o/devicestate: consider the current model's validation sets when creating a recovery system Andrew Phelps 2024-02-20 15:42:09 -05:00
  • b79debc962 o/assertstate: add function to get enforced validation sets that are associated with a model Andrew Phelps 2024-02-20 15:22:07 -05:00
  • 535f048bc4 interfaces/apparmor/template: add read access to /etc/default/keyboard Jorge Sancho Larraz 2024-02-22 10:00:53 +01:00
  • dc3fb2471a overlord: fix race in refresh monitoring tests Maciej Borzecki 2024-02-22 14:34:45 +01:00
  • 01dcdd0ece interfaces: we actually expect snaps to auto-connect to desktop Samuele Pedroni 2024-02-13 13:18:28 +01:00
  • a282087172 many: apply new home directory rules to data copy (#13145) ghadi-rahme 2024-02-22 12:08:42 +02:00
  • 8c247eaf5a overlord, o/devicestate: support remodeling on hybrid models (#13464) Andrew Phelps 2024-02-22 01:47:52 -05:00
  • 19baffdf08 kernel,overlord: use function from kernel pkg to get kernel early Alfonso Sánchez-Beato 2024-02-16 11:25:44 +00:00
  • 6a7ecfe597 aspects: validate summary descriptions (#13609) Miguel Pires 2024-02-21 13:38:08 +00:00
  • bea2d80284 o/servicestate: add unmarshal tests for Instruction Philip Meulengracht 2024-02-20 10:21:28 +01:00
  • 1049780dbd daemon,o/servicestate: fix selecting all users for non-root users Philip Meulengracht 2024-02-19 09:56:48 +01:00
  • 77437aa51e daemon,o/servicestate: handle not-set scope and simplify error messages Philip Meulengracht 2024-02-15 13:43:32 +01:00
  • 13209f518b daemon,o/servicestate: support for scopes and users in API for services Philip Meulengracht 2023-10-27 10:36:34 +02:00
  • 20cd4b7db1 tests/main/interfaces-ros-opt-data: disable on Ubuntu Core Valentin David 2024-02-21 09:59:39 +01:00
  • d935048f4e build(deps): bump tj-actions/changed-files in /.github/workflows dependabot[bot] 2024-02-21 08:58:27 +00:00
  • 14fe483a96 o/snapstate: add "refresh-forced" api-data field to auto-refresh changes Zeyad Gouda 2024-02-15 20:58:05 +02:00
  • d264d4e732 o/aspectstate: get local aspect-bundle assertions (#13585) Miguel Pires 2024-02-21 09:06:22 +00:00
  • 9712748dff kernel,overlord: modify EnsureKernelDriversTree so it can handle Alfonso Sánchez-Beato 2024-02-13 15:15:58 +00:00
  • 8bb2e5af5a overlord: add managers test for auto-refresh with pre-download and app monitoring Maciej Borzecki 2024-02-20 09:52:16 +01:00
  • e5760034f4 overlord: tweak managers tests names Maciej Borzecki 2024-02-20 09:51:59 +01:00